New appeal as concern grows for woman

POLICE have made a fresh appeal for information on the whereabouts of a missing Edinburgh woman.

Elizabeth Brown was reported missing when her family began to worry after not hearing from her since 22 May.

Lothian and Borders Police said she was last seen on Friday 28 May disembarking a bus in Nicolson Street wearing a black jacket, open-neck blouse, blue jeans and black shoes. She was carrying two Aldi bags.

Ms Brown, 55, also known as Betty, is 5ft 7in (1m 70cm), with fair hair and glasses.

Police said they were growing increasingly concerned because her prescribed medication finished on Sunday and none of her pay has been withdrawn.

Inspector Murray Dykes said: "The fact that Betty's medication has run out and her pay has been left untouched in her bank is giving us cause for concern, as we are told this is highly unusual."

Police are trying to find out whether Ms Brown, from Hawick, could have travelled to the Borders.
